Ingredients

  • 1/2 cups Honey
  • 1 cup Brown Sugar
  • 1/2 cups Orange Juice
  • 1 whole Fully Cooked Bone-in Half Shank Ham (6-7 Pounds)
  • Handful Of Whole Cloves

Method

  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the honey, brown sugar, and orange juice; set aside.
  • Using a sharp knife, cut off the hard rind and some of the fat around the ham; score the ham in a diamond pattern.
  • Stud the ham with the cloves, placing them in the slits.
  • Place ham cut side down on a rack in a shallow pan.
  • Drizzle 1/3 of the glaze over the ham, spreading evenly.
  • Bake until an instant-read thermometer inserted into the thickest part reads 130 degrees to 140 degrees F (approximately 1 3/4 to 2 hours depending on the weight of your ham).
  • Drizzle the glaze 2 to 3 more times during the cooking process, spacing as evenly as you can, with the final drizzle during the last half hour.
  • Let ham rest for 15 minutes before carving.
